BMS students show off their French speaking skills

Language leaders and other students across the school have recently volunteered to take part in a project to share their knowledge and skills in French with pupils at primary level. Building on activities which students do in class with their language teachers, they have worked independently to record impressive videos which we are sharing with our colleagues in the primary schools. The videos model to the younger students how to pronounce the vocabulary they are learning in class. At the same time, they are excellent revision for our secondary language students too. All students who participated have received R4s for their excellent efforts, and the following prizes were also awarded
